阻止apache上的head请求

时间:2018-09-18 00:40:29

标签: apache post mod-rewrite get head

你好,我在xmapp上运行apache,我收到了很多我认为是机器人或类似东西的请求,使用了不同的ip和不同的用户代理,但我注意到它是唯一使HEAD产生的原因在GET请求之前发出请求,而正常流量仅使用POST和GET。所以我的想法是禁止HEAD请求或只允许GET和POST。我尝试了两种方法:

<Directory "C:/xampp/htdocs">
<LimitExcept GET POST>
    Order deny,allow
    Deny from all
</LimitExcept>
</Directory>

RewriteEngine On
RewriteCond %{REQUEST_METHOD} ^(TRACK|PUT|OPTIONS|DELETE|HEAD) [NC]
RewriteRule /.* http://localhost/ [L,R]

没有任何效果,那么我将如何阻止或重定向HEAD请求?

0 个答案:

没有答案